Competitors In Tune At The Biddulph Festival
Karen Bradley joined hundreds of singers, players and supporters at the annual Biddulph and Moorlands Music Festival on Saturday. The contestants took part in over 40 different classes of competition at Biddulph High School.
Karen said:
"It's great to see so many performers enjoying themselves and showing what they can do. There is an amazing array of talent on show in Biddulph - the town's a real hot bed of the arts. The music festival is yet another thing I'll be proudly telling people outside the Moorlands about."
Karen is pictured with President of the Music Festival, Norman Millard and County Cllr Ian Lawson during a break in the competition.
